A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

微信小程序后端用什么语言

   2025-04-20 12
导读

微信小程序后端开发主要使用JavaScript(包括TypeScript)语言。这是因为微信小程序是基于JavaScript运行的,而小程序框架本身也提供了丰富的API和工具来支持后端开发。

微信小程序后端开发主要使用JavaScript(包括TypeScript)语言。这是因为微信小程序是基于JavaScript运行的,而小程序框架本身也提供了丰富的API和工具来支持后端开发。

在微信小程序中,后端通常指的是服务器端,也就是处理用户请求、数据库操作等业务逻辑的部分。这部分功能主要通过Node.js来实现。Node.js是一种基于Chrome V8引擎的JavaScript运行时环境,可以用于构建高性能的网络应用。

以下是一些常用的Node.js库和技术:

1. Express:一个快速、简单、灵活的Web应用框架,可以处理HTTP请求和响应,以及中间件。

2. Koa:一个基于Node.js的非阻塞网络框架,提供了更简洁的异步编程模型和更高级的路由抽象。

3. MongoDB:一个开源的NoSQL数据库,可以存储结构化和非结构化数据。

4. Socket.io:一个实时通信系统,可以实现客户端和服务器之间的双向通信。

5. Redis:一个高性能的键值存储系统,可以用于缓存、消息队列等场景。

6. MySQL:一个关系型数据库管理系统,可以用于存储结构化数据。

7. RabbitMQ:一个开源的消息队列系统,可以用于实现分布式系统中的异步通信。

微信小程序后端用什么语言

8. PubSub:一个事件驱动的消息传递系统,可以实现发布/订阅模式。

9. Vue.js:一个渐进式JavaScript框架,可以用于构建用户界面。

10. Axios:一个基于Promise的HTTP客户端,可以简化HTTP请求的处理。

在微信小程序后端开发中,除了使用Node.js和上述提到的库和技术外,还需要关注以下几个方面:

1. 安全性:由于微信小程序涉及到用户的隐私和数据安全,后端需要采用适当的安全措施,如加密传输、身份验证等。

2. 性能优化:微信小程序的性能要求较高,后端需要考虑如何优化代码、减少资源消耗、提高响应速度等方面。

3. 可扩展性:随着业务的不断扩展,后端需要具备良好的可扩展性,以便在未来添加新功能或修改现有功能。

4. 错误处理:后端需要能够正确处理各种可能出现的错误情况,并提供友好的错误提示信息。

总之,微信小程序后端开发主要使用JavaScript(包括TypeScript)语言,并结合Node.js、相关库和技术进行开发。在开发过程中,需要注意安全性、性能优化、可扩展性和错误处理等方面的问题。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-729159.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
 
 
更多>同类知识

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部